What is Sports Tourism?

Sports tourism refers to traveling to participate in or watch sporting events. It encompasses a wide range of activities, from attending major international competitions like the Olympics and World Cup to participating in marathons and other sporting events. The Future of Sports Tourism Worldwide is influenced by various factors, including cultural significance, economic impact, and the growing interest in health and wellness.

Current Trends Shaping Sports Tourism

As we look toward the future, several trends are emerging that will significantly impact sports tourism:

  • Technological Integration: The use of technology in sports tourism is on the rise. Virtual reality experiences, augmented reality applications, and mobile apps enhance the spectator experience, allowing fans to engage with events like never before.
  • Sustainability Initiatives: With growing awareness of environmental issues, the sports tourism industry is shifting towards sustainable practices. This includes eco-friendly accommodations, sustainable transportation options, and events that prioritize environmental responsibility.
  • Health and Wellness Focus: The pandemic has heightened the importance of health and wellness. Sports tourism is increasingly catering to travelers seeking fitness retreats, wellness festivals, and active vacations that promote a healthy lifestyle.
  • Local Experiences: Travelers are increasingly interested in authentic local experiences. Sports tourism is evolving to include cultural and community engagement, allowing visitors to connect with local traditions and sports.

The Role of Major Events

Major sporting events play a crucial role in shaping the future of sports tourism worldwide. Events such as the FIFA World Cup, the Summer and Winter Olympics, and various international championships attract millions of visitors and generate substantial economic impact for host cities.

These events not only boost local economies but also create lasting legacies in terms of infrastructure, tourism promotion, and community engagement. For instance, the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ris is expected to enhance the city’s global profile and stimulate tourism long after the games conclude.

Challenges Facing Sports Tourism

Despite the promising outlook, the future of sports tourism worldwide faces several challenges:

  • Health Concerns: The ongoing impact of global health crises, such as the COVID-19 pandemic, poses a significant challenge. Safety measures and travel restrictions can deter tourists from attending events.
  • Economic Uncertainty: Economic fluctuations can affect disposable income and travel budgets, impacting the willingness of individuals to invest in sports tourism.
  • Environmental Impact: While sustainability is a growing trend, the environmental impact of large-scale events remains a concern. Balancing tourism growth with ecological preservation is essential.

Innovative Solutions for the Future

To address these challenges and capitalize on opportunities, the sports tourism industry is exploring innovative solutions:

  • Hybrid Events: Combining in-person attendance with virtual participation can expand audience reach and provide flexibility for attendees.
  • Smart Destinations: Utilizing data and technology to enhance visitor experiences, from smart transportation systems to personalized itineraries, can improve the overall tourism experience.
  • Community Engagement Programs: Involving local communities in sports tourism initiatives fosters a sense of ownership and promotes sustainable practices.

The Future of Sports Tourism Worldwide: A Global Perspective

The future of sports tourism worldwide is not uniform; it varies significantly across regions. In emerging markets, sports tourism is seen as a catalyst for economic development and cultural exchange. Countries like Qatar and China are investing heavily in sports infrastructure to attract international events and tourists.

In contrast, established markets like Europe and North America are focusing on enhancing existing offerings, promoting sustainability, and integrating technology into the sports tourism experience.
